Addis Ababa's tourism authority and smartphone maker Tecno Ethiopia have formed a strategic partnership to integrate technology into the promotion of Ethiopia's tourism sector, as the companies seek to expand digital tools for showcasing the country's attractions.

The agreement was signed during the launch of the third edition of Tecno Ethiopia's photography exhibition at the Children's and Youth Theatre Complex, an event jointly organised with the Addis Ababa Tourism Commission and Board Cell Phone Addis Ababa.

Running for 10 days, the exhibition presents more than 100 photographs created using advanced camera systems and artificial intelligence technologies. Organisers expect the event to attract more than 10,000 visitors while highlighting the role of digital innovation in photography, creativity and destination marketing.

The newly signed partnership will see the Addis Ababa Tourism Commission and Tecno Ethiopia collaborate on technology based initiatives aimed at making tourism destinations more accessible and visible. The cooperation also seeks to increase public awareness of Ethiopia's natural and historical heritage through digital platforms.

According to the organisers, the initiative is intended to support national image building by combining technological innovation with tourism promotion, while creating new opportunities for the country's creative industry and encouraging greater engagement with Ethiopia's cultural and tourism assets.
